Overview

McDonald's in Port St. Lucie has been inspected 20 times with 97 total violations, averaging 4.9 violations per inspection, slightly below the statewide average of 5.2. Employee health reporting violations appeared in at least 5 inspections between 2023 and 2025, including high-priority findings in August and April 2024–2025. The facility has not experienced an emergency closure. The most recent inspection on November 19, 2025 resulted in call back compliance with zero violations; a prior inspection on November 4, 2025 issued a warning for two intermediate violations.
